Jicama has a lot of fiber (6 grams per cup) and water (90% water content). a good source of carbohydrates, jicama is naturally low in fat but high in fiber. one cup of raw jicama contains 6 grams (g) of fiber and less than 50 calories. Filling fiber for regularity and weight loss. jicama is a good source of fiber. About 2 grams of naturally occurring sugar. Jicama's high fiber content makes it a low glycemic index (gi) food, meaning it doesn't cause blood sugar (glucose) levels to spike. Jicama is rich in a type of prebiotic fiber that helps restore the good bacteria in your gut. Because of the high fiber content in jicama, it is considered a low glycemic food. jicama has dietary fiber, which may lower cholesterol levels.
